Ivan Pereverzev was not only a brilliant actor, but also an incorrigible womanizer and heartthrob. Women wrote him sensual letters and even threatened to commit suicide in the absence of an answer from him. Only at the age of 53 did he meet the one with whom he was able to build a real family. But fate released Ivan Pereverzev and Olga Solovyova only 11 years of happiness.
From peasants to artists
Ivan Pereverzev was born and raised in the most ordinary peasant family, dreamed of joining a sailor, but became a fitter at the Sharikopodshipnik plant.
A friend of Ivan Romka dreamed of becoming an artist and convinced his friend that, with his height and appearance, he needed to play in the movies, and not stand at the machine. Pereverzev was admitted to the school at the Moscow Theater of the Revolution, but no talent was found in Romka.
Ivan Pereverzev as a student turned out to be very capable and after graduating from college he was immediately recruited to the Theater of the Revolution, after he moved to the Theater of the Mossovet, and since 1945 he began to work in the theater-studio of the film actor. Since 1933, the actor began acting in films.
When the war began, Ivan Pereverzev was in Odessa filming "Sea Hawk". Odessa was already shaken by the explosions, and the artists demanded that they be immediately sent to active military units, they wanted to beat the enemy. But the film's consultant, Rear Admiral Gavriil Zhukov, who led the defense of Odessa, severely reprimanded the actors. After all, with their films, they could bring much more benefit to victory than weapons that they do not know how to use.
"First glove" and first love
In 1946, the film The First Glove was released with Ivan Pereverzev in the title role. He played boxer Nikita Krutikov. A man who had never been interested in boxing began to spend several rounds a day in the ring in order to reliably convey not only the image of his hero, but also to show the technique of the game.

Later happiness
Ivan Pereverzev met his happiness in 1967. On the motor ship "Crimea", which made voyages between Odessa and Batumi, the film "Angel's Day" was filmed, in which Ivan Pereverzev played the captain. Olga Solovyova at that time worked at the Odessa Film Studio as an assistant director for actors.
She was only 26 years old, he was almost 53. The girl treated the actor with the greatest respect, and he immediately saw her as a future wife. During the first meeting, he presented her with a bottle of perfume "Perhaps", in the dining room he took a place for Olenka next to him.
All three months, while the shooting lasted, they constantly talked. Olga even confided in him her romantic secrets. Ivan Fedorovich watched her all the time. Even when she met her boyfriend, the sea captain, at the pier.
After the end of filming, Pereverzev did not leave for Moscow, he again came to the film studio. Soon he invited Olga to become his wife. The girl did not take his words seriously and was completely at a loss when he asked her to give an answer.
She deeply respected him as an actor, as a person. But I didn't feel any feelings for him. The girl herself could not answer the question of why she agreed. However, Ivan Fedorovich did everything to make Olga fall in love with him and be happy with him.
Before that, he often told friends: all his love affairs and even families are the result of weakness in front of female pressure. He did not conquer women, but they conquered him. With Olga everything was different. He touchingly courted her, cooked his signature borscht and, it seems, was absolutely happy.
Ivan Fedorovich and Olga had a son. The happiest time was when they put Fedenka to bed, sat down in the kitchen and had long, long conversations. It seems that life was not enough for them to talk too much.
He quit drinking, began to take good care of his health and dreamed of seeing his son come of age. He told his wife: "How I would like to live with you for another 20 years …"
Ivan Pereverzev died at the age of 63. For a long time Olga could not come to terms with the pain of loss, she devoted her whole life to her son and allowed herself to get married when she already had grandchildren.
